How they compare
Lebanon currently reports 214,430 number against 192,954 number in Eritrea, a difference of 21,476 number.
That makes Lebanon's figure about 1.1 times Eritrea's.
Across all 16 years both countries report, Lebanon has been ahead every year.
Eritrea ranks 117th and Lebanon ranks 115th of 206 countries.
Lebanon has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

About this data
Population of the age-group theoretically corresponding to pre-primary education as indicated by theoretical entrance age and duration.
